Installation of new kitchen

In April I had a new kitchen fitted. After completion there were various problems the most obvious being a pipe sticking out my wall due to incorrect measurements being taken. All the plug points were loose, the oven was loose, wiring done badly, cables cut in the wall and not repaired by plastered over, pot drawer badly fitted - it topples over and hinges in the drawers popping. Screws were covered by a stickers and I had to purchase the correct plastic caps as all the stickers peeled off. The fitting and finishing of the cupboards is sub-standard. No qualified electricians or plumbers were used and the result is obvious.

I contacted Mark Willis and had to follow up a couple of times before he agreed to sort out the snag list. This was never completed and I now have to replace ALL the hinges in the drawers which have all popped as well as try to cover the protruding pipe.
